Warning Signs You Need Flooring Replacement After Water Damage

Beyond the obvious signs of water damage, there are several warning signs that show you need flooring replacement.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these warning signs. Act quickly to prevent further damage. Our team is here to help.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ors that linger in your home can be a sign of hidden water damage. These odors can show the presence of mold and mildew, which can pose serious health risks. Don’t ignore musty odors. Address the issue quickly. Our team will help you remove the odor.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. This can lead to further damage and even structural issues. Don’t ignore warped flooring. Address the issue quickly. Our team will help you repair or replace the flooring.

Discoloration or Stains

Discoloration or stains on your flooring can be a sign of water damage. These stains can show the presence of mineral deposits or other substances that can damage your flooring. Don’t ignore discoloration or stains. Address the issue quickly. Our team will help you restore your flooring.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, isolated water damage Yes No DIY can be effective for small areas, but be cautious of hidden damage.
Large water damage or structural issues No Yes Professionals have the equipment and expertise to handle complex water damage and structural issues.
Hidden water damage or mold growth No Yes Professionals can detect hidden water damage and mold growth, which can pose serious health risks.
Time-sensitive or urgent situations No Yes Professionals can respond quickly and efficiently to time-sensitive or urgent situations, reducing further damage.
Unfamiliar with water damage restoration No Yes Professionals have the training and experience to handle water damage restoration, ensuring a successful outcome.
Need specialized equipment or expertise No Yes Professionals have access to specialized equipment and expertise, ensuring a thorough and effective restoration.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Granby, MA

The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Granby, MA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can help you plan your budget.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Free estimates are available.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Removal of Damaged Flooring $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Installation of New Flooring $1,000 – $5,000 Type of flooring, size of affected area
Water Damage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Specialized Equipment and Expertise $500 – $2,000 Complexity of damage, size of affected area
Free Estimates and Consultations $0 – $100 Location, complexity of damage
Insurance Claims Help $0 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
